发票生成器概述
使用 MerchandAise 发票生成器创建可打印的发票,其中包含公司和客户详细信息、发票日期、明细行项目、自动增值税计算、本地草稿恢复和基于浏览器的 PDF 导出。
发票工作流程
- 在打印之前添加公司和客户详细信息,以便发票具有完整的发件人和收件人信息。
- 输入发票标识符,例如发票编号、发票日期、到期日、联系人和订单号。
- 添加、复制或删除行项目,同时小计、增值税和总计会自动更新。
- 当您需要在打印或保存为 PDF 之前预览品牌发票时,请上传公司徽标。
- 使用主要打印操作打开浏览器打印对话框或在 QA 线束模式下捕获打印事件。
可见页面部分
- Hero:将路线命名为发票生成器并解释打印就绪的用途。
- 公司信息部分:收集发件人姓名和地址详细信息。
- 客户信息部分:收集收件人姓名和地址详细信息。
- 发票详细信息部分:收集发票标识符和日期。
- 项目部分:管理描述、数量、单价、重复、删除和添加项目操作。
- 总计卡:显示小计、19% 的增值税以及最终总计。
计算和验证
- 小计等于所有行项目的数量总和乘以单价。
- 增值税等于小计乘以 0.19。
- 总计等于小计加上增值税。
- 数量必须是大于或等于 0 的整数。
- 单价必须是大于或等于 0 的数字。
- 发票中必须至少保留一项行项目。
草稿存储和隐私
此路由上的发票草稿仅存储在当前设备上的当前浏览器中。清除草稿将删除该浏览器会话历史记录的已保存本地副本。
机器可读的路线输入
invoiceData
用于预填充发票字段的可选 JSON 查询参数。无效的 JSON 可以安全地退回到空白发票草稿。
qaPrintHarness
可选标志,无需打开浏览器打印对话框即可捕获打印操作。
发票生成器常见问题解答
我可以将发票另存为 PDF 吗?
是的。使用主打印操作打开浏览器打印对话框,然后选择浏览器中可用的“另存为 PDF”选项。
我的发票草稿存储在哪里?
草稿存储在当前设备和浏览器的本地浏览器存储中。它们不会自动跨设备共享。
发票总额是如何计算的?
每个行项目将数量乘以单价。该页面将这些值汇总到小计中,应用 19% 的增值税,然后显示最终总计。